Clearly I need an infusion of chocolate ... stat! And not just any chocolate either - a funky, fun, new chocolate that I've just discovered. Its dark, rich, and slightly crisp; a deliciously decadent, grown-up version of a crunch bar - and its my new favorite indulgence.

The sweetriot unBAR is all-natural, gluten-free, dairy-free and made from responsibly sourced fair-trade cacao. The bar itself contains a host of yummy, delicious cacao nibs that add wonderful texture, crunch and flavor - and the chocolate itself is magnificent. It comes in two "strengths" - 70% dark chocolate or 65% dark chocolate ... and, oddly enough, I prefer the 65%. I tasted both and find the 65 less sweet.

Were you to possess the kind of self-control necessary to eat only one square ... the calorie count is fairly low: 48 calories per square. You can do the rest of the math, but this much I'll tell you - one square is perfectly satisfying and two are enough. The bar is so rich, you simply do not need to eat the whole thing to enjoy it.

I came across the unBAR while shopping in Zabar's one day and happily for me, they were giving free samples. Trust me, it was love at first bite! In addition to the bars, sweetriot also offers both raw and chocolate covered cacao beans for your snacking pleasure. I can't wait to try them, cacao nibs are one of my most favorite things. Let the antioxidant-rich snacking begin!

As for price, well, the bars aren't cheap - $2.79 per bar, though keep in mind that's a Zabar's price. That said, the indulgence is well worth the splurge. This is a quality product and I'm happy to pay for responsibly sourced ingredients. The company is committed to fair-trade, uses recycled materials for packaging and is dedicated to making the world a better place. Take a spin around their site and you'll see what I mean.
